Job Description:
Procurement Specialist
Newcastle upon Tyne
Hybrid Working (2 days in the office)
12 Month Fixed Term
Excellent Benefits
Salary Negotiable - mid level role
Sellick Partnership are currently assisting my professional services client to recruit a Procurement Specialist on a 12 month fixed term basis.
The Procurement Specialist will be a role with a lot of autonomy with responsibility for tender processes, market analysis and supplier negotiation for renewals and service engagements.
You will have excellent internal and external stakeholder communication skills as well as strong commercial accumen.
Essentials skills:
*Strong supplier and contracts negotiation/ management skills.
*Proven experience in a procurement role ideally within a professional services environment.
*Experience with procurement tools, contract management systems and tendering platforms.
*CIPS qualification is desirable but not essential.
